Empowering Marketing Agencies with Tailored WordPress Solutions to Overcome Technical Challenges and Drive Client Success

Category: Portfolio | Tags: agencies client performance plugins themes wordpress

In today’s digital landscape, marketing agencies face an ever-increasing demand for seamless, high-performing websites that deliver exceptional user experiences. However, many agencies encounter significant technical challenges when it comes to building and maintaining WordPress sites. This is where tailored WordPress solutions can make a profound impact. By leveraging customized development strategies, marketing agencies can not only overcome these hurdles but also drive client success, enhance their service offerings, and ultimately increase their revenue. As a WordPress developer, I understand the intricacies of the platform and how to implement solutions that align with business goals, ensuring that agencies can focus on what they do best—marketing.

Understanding the Technical Challenges Faced by Marketing Agencies

Marketing agencies often juggle multiple projects, each with unique requirements and timelines. This can lead to several technical challenges, including:

  • Performance Optimization: Slow-loading websites can lead to high bounce rates and lost conversions.
  • Customization Needs: Off-the-shelf themes often do not meet specific client needs, necessitating custom solutions.
  • Plugin Management: Using too many plugins can create compatibility issues and security vulnerabilities.
  • SEO Optimization: Ensuring that the website is optimized for search engines while maintaining a user-friendly experience.

Addressing these challenges not only improves the performance of the websites but also enhances client satisfaction, leading to stronger relationships and repeat business. By employing tailored WordPress solutions, agencies can effectively manage these technical hurdles and deliver superior results.

Implementing Performance Optimization Strategies

One of the most common issues agencies face is website performance. A slow website can adversely affect user experience and SEO rankings. Here are a few strategies to optimize performance:

Utilizing Caching Solutions

Implementing caching can significantly improve load times. Popular caching plugins like W3 Total Cache or WP Super Cache can help store static versions of your pages, reducing server load.

Image Optimization

Large images can slow down your website. Use plugins like WP Smush to compress images without losing quality. Additionally, consider using the WebP format for even better performance.

Enabling GZIP Compression

GZIP compression can reduce the size of your files, which in turn increases the speed of your website. This can be enabled via your .htaccess file or through various plugins.

Customizing WordPress Themes to Meet Client Needs

Generic themes often fall short of meeting specific client requirements. Customizing themes can provide a unique identity and functionality that resonates with the client’s brand. Here’s how to go about it:

Child Themes for Customization

Creating a child theme is essential for making customizations without affecting the parent theme. This allows for smooth updates and the preservation of changes. To create a child theme:

  1. Create a new folder in the /wp-content/themes/ directory.
  2. Add a style.css file with the necessary header information.
  3. Enqueue the parent theme styles in your functions.php file.

Custom Page Templates

Developing custom page templates allows agencies to create unique layouts for different pages. This is particularly useful for landing pages or service pages that require distinct designs.

Managing Plugins Effectively

While plugins extend WordPress functionality, too many can lead to conflicts and security issues. Here are best practices for managing plugins:

Essential Plugins Only

Maintain a lean plugin list by only using those that are absolutely necessary. This minimizes the risk of compatibility issues and enhances performance.

Regular Updates and Security Checks

Always keep plugins updated to their latest versions to protect against vulnerabilities. Tools like WP Checkup can help monitor the health of your site.

SEO Optimization Techniques for WordPress Sites

Effective SEO is crucial for driving traffic to client websites. Here are some tailored strategies:

Using SEO Plugins

Implementing SEO plugins like Yoast SEO can help streamline optimization efforts. These plugins provide valuable insights and suggestions for improving on-page SEO.

Structured Data Implementation

Adding structured data can enhance search visibility and click-through rates. Use Schema.org markup to help search engines understand your content better.

Step-by-Step Guide to Developing a Custom WordPress Plugin

Creating a custom plugin can solve unique client needs effectively. Here’s a simple step-by-step guide:

  1. Create a new folder in /wp-content/plugins/ and name it appropriately.
  2. Inside the folder, create a plugin-name.php file and add the plugin header.
  3. Write your custom functions within this file.
  4. Activate your plugin from the WordPress admin dashboard.

This process empowers agencies to tailor functionalities to specific client requests, thereby increasing satisfaction and retention.

Frequently Asked Questions

What are the benefits of using a child theme for customization?

Child themes allow developers to customize a parent theme without losing the changes when the parent theme is updated. This practice ensures that your customizations remain intact while benefiting from the latest features and security updates of the parent theme.

How can I ensure my WordPress site is secure?

To secure your WordPress site, always keep your WordPress version, themes, and plugins updated. Additionally, use security plugins like iThemes Security to monitor for vulnerabilities and enhance security settings.

What role do performance metrics play in client success?

Performance metrics such as page load time, bounce rate, and conversion rate are critical indicators of user experience and satisfaction. By regularly analyzing these metrics, agencies can make informed decisions to optimize sites, leading to improved client success.

Why is it important to limit the number of plugins used on a WordPress site?

Using too many plugins can lead to conflicts, slow down site performance, and create security vulnerabilities. It’s essential to evaluate the necessity of each plugin and only use those that add significant value to the site.

How do custom page templates enhance user experience?

Custom page templates allow agencies to design unique layouts tailored to specific content or marketing goals. This customization can result in a more engaging user experience, ultimately driving conversions and meeting client objectives.

Conclusion

By empowering marketing agencies with tailored WordPress solutions, developers can help them navigate technical challenges and enhance client success. The integration of performance optimization, effective plugin management, SEO strategies, and customized themes not only addresses common issues but also positions agencies as leaders in their field. As a WordPress developer, I can provide the expertise needed to elevate your projects and drive impactful results.

If you are looking for a skilled WordPress developer to help transform your agency’s offerings and tackle technical challenges effectively, contact me today. Let’s discuss how we can work together to elevate your clients’ success and streamline your development processes.

Contact Me

TOP 3% TALENT

Vetted by Hire me
Need a WordPress Expert?